Elasticsearch集群的安装和配置涉及多个步骤,包括环境准备、J***a
JDK的安装、Elasticsearch的安装、集群角色的分配以及Elasticsearch.yml的设置。以下是对搜索结果的综合整理,以帮助您更好地了解Elasticsearch集群的安装和配置过程。
首先,确保您的系统满足Elasticsearch的运行要求。Elasticsearch
5.4.3至少需要J***a
8,您可以从JDK***直接下载jdk8u131linuxx64.tar.gz。同时,还需要注意操作系统的最大文件打开数和内存映射数等限制。
接下来,从Elasticsearch***下载相应版本的安装包,并将其解压到指定目录。在每台主机上,根据实际情况分配不同的实例,并在每个实例的目录下创建一个elasticsearch.yml文件。
在Elasticsearch集群中,节点可以分为master
nodes和data
nodes。通过Zen发现(ZenDiscovery)机制,可以实现不同节点的管理。只要启动一个新的Elasticsearch节点并设置与集群相同的名称,该节点就会被加入到集群中。
Elasticsearch集群中每个节点的角色可以是master
node、data
node或client
node。为了实现高可用性和良好的性能,可以根据实际需求对节点进行合理的角色分配。
最后,在elasticsearch.yml文件中设置相应的参数,以满足集群的需求。请注意,同一台主机上的不同实例应分别配置,并确保每个参数名称与值之间用空格隔开。
总之,Elasticsearch集群的安装和配置需要仔细规划和实施。通过对J***a
JDK、Elasticsearch安装、节点角色分配以及Elasticsearch.yml设置的深入了解,您可以成功地搭建起一个高效稳定的Elasticsearch集群。
追问
延伸阅读
参考资料为您提炼了 4 个关键词,查找到 95802 篇相关资料。